Q: Has anyone experienced problems with either the kpa index or table look up that provides radically different VE returns depending upon if you approach the cell's kpa value from the high side or the low side? I can actually use a poteniameter to simulate a MAP sensor, set my rpm input on 5000 and approach a 90 KPA cell site from below and get one VE and from above and get a radically different one. Here is some more information. You can see by http://www.lolachampcar.com/images/VE%20Lookup%20Problem.pdf that VE is changing radically with but a small change in RPM. The VE table that fed the above data can be seen at http://www.lolachampcar.com/images/Ve%20lookup%20problem%20ve%20table.pdf. I believe the firmware is picking the indexs when rpm is above 5000 and thus defining the four VE cell values to use. Then it is using the below 5000 rpm number when it does the actual weighting. This would tend to weight the VE towards the higher cell (as it would finding 4999's location between 4500 and 5000) while using the VE value pulled from a 5003 rpm reading. In short, the input to the lookup function is not time aligned such that the four VE values from one point in time are being weighted by data from another point in time. When the data oscilates around a cell, bad things happen. Has anyone seen this problem before and is it something you guys are concerned about? Thanks, Bill
